Blocking issues:

  • An action sourced from a third-party repository on GitHub is not pinned to a full length commit SHA. Pinning an action to a full length commit SHA is currently the only way to use an action as an immutable release. Pinning to a particular SHA helps mitigate the risk of a bad actor adding a backdoor to the action's repository, as they would need to generate a SHA-1 collision for a valid Git object payload. 🧹 Nitpick comments (7)
.gitignore (1)

196-196: Ignore CodSpeed artifacts: prefer directory-anchored pattern

Use a root-anchored directory pattern to avoid accidentally matching files with the same name elsewhere.

-.codspeed
+/.codspeed/
.github/workflows/ci.yaml (2)

241-245: Result job should also gate on benchmarks’ outcome in the check step

You added benchmarks to needs, but the failure/cancel check below only covers tests and lint. Include benchmarks for consistency and explicit gating.

-      - name: Mark workflow as failed if lint or test did not pass or were cancelled
-        if: contains(fromJson('["failure", "cancelled"]'), needs.tests.result) || contains(fromJson('["failure", "cancelled"]'), needs.lint.result)
+      - name: Mark workflow as failed if lint, tests, or benchmarks did not pass or were cancelled
+        if: |
+          contains(fromJson('["failure","cancelled"]'), needs.tests.result) ||
+          contains(fromJson('["failure","cancelled"]'), needs.lint.result)   ||
+          contains(fromJson('["failure","cancelled"]'), needs.benchmarks.result)
         run: exit 1

130-140: Cache scope nit: include UV dir explicitly

Caching ~/.cache works, but being explicit improves portability and avoids noise.

       path: |
-        ~/.cache
+        ~/.cache/uv
+        ~/.cache/pip

🧹 Nitpick comments (4)
.github/workflows/ci.yaml (4)

130-133: Remove Buildx in benchmarks (unused).

No Docker build here; drop to speed up and reduce surface.

-      - name: Set up Docker Buildx
-        id: docker-buildx
-        uses: docker/setup-buildx-action@v3

52-57: Use the canonical GITHUB_OUTPUT write; avoid tee and add quotes.

Prevents subtle formatting bugs with spaces/newlines.

-      - name: Generate test matrix
-        id: set-matrix
-        shell: bash
-        run: |
-          echo sessions=$(mise run ci:test-matrix) | tee --append $GITHUB_OUTPUT
+      - name: Generate test matrix
+        id: set-matrix
+        shell: bash
+        run: |
+          echo "sessions=$(mise run ci:test-matrix)" >> "$GITHUB_OUTPUT"

184-191: Typo + pinning: “Codecov” and pin action to SHA.

Fix step name; pin action.

-      - name: Upload coverage to Codeocv
+      - name: Upload coverage to Codecov
-        uses: codecov/codecov-action@v5
+        uses: codecov/codecov-action@<full-commit-sha> # v5

15-18: Set minimal permissions; override per-job where needed.

Harden workflow by default least-privilege. Grant extra (e.g., checks: write, pull-requests: write) only to jobs that need them (Codecov test-results, release dispatch).

 concurrency:
   group: ${{ github.head_ref || github.run_id }}
   cancel-in-progress: true
+
+permissions:
+  contents: read
